STRIKE IN SIBERIA.

TROUBLE ON THE RAILWAY. AtistraJiin and N.Z. Cable Association. Tlwd 8 D.m.) NEW YORK, Aug. 8. A despatch from Pekin states that all traffic on the trans-Siberian railroad is held up on account of a strike of employees. The employees demand payment in the old currency, instead of in the new Siberian notes.
